Direct answer
Audit firms and internal audit teams deploy AI agents to compress evidence collection — reconciliations, subscription registers, access reviews, policy drift scans, security questionnaire drafts — while partners retain sign-off. Pattern Automation implements audit-adjacent automation on Neuro OS: read-heavy agents, proposed findings as reviewed changes, never silent writes to client systems.
This is not “AI replaces the auditor.” It is AI removes copy-paste between client exports, workpapers, and review notes.
Selection criteria
- Read-only default on client production systems
- Workpaper format — outputs land in your template (Excel, Google Sheets, PDF pack)
- Citation — each finding links to source row, log line, or document version
- Engagement isolation — separate connector scopes per client
- No training on client data without contract — model policy documented
Architecture
Client export / secure read replica
→ Extraction + normalization agent
→ Rule pack (playbook in git, versioned per engagement)
→ Exception list + suggested workpaper entries
→ Auditor review in portal / Slack / Sheets
→ Optional: draft client request list (Ask before send)
Common roles: expense reconciliation, SaaS/subscription completeness, access policy drift, month-end checklist alignment, security questionnaire first pass.

Limitations
- Audit opinion remains human — agents supply schedules and exceptions, not sign-offs.
- Judgment areas (fraud, going concern, complex estimates) stay partner-led.
- Client NDA and data access must be in place before connectors go live.
- Agents fail loudly on incomplete exports — garbage in still requires human stop.
